π« Maltesers Chocolate Crepe Rolls

π§Ύ Ingredients
For the Crepes
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 eggs
- 1 1/2 cups milk
- 2 tbsp melted butter
- 1 tbsp sugar
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- Pinch of salt
For the Filling
- 1 cup chocolate spread (Nutella or similar)
- 1/2 cup crushed Maltesers
- 1/4 cup chocolate chips
For Topping
- Whole Maltesers
- Extra chocolate drizzle
- Crushed biscuits (optional)
π¨βπ³ Instructions

Step 1: Make the Crepe Batter
- In a bowl, whisk together flour, eggs, milk, butter, sugar, vanilla, and salt.
- Mix until smooth and lump-free.
- Let the batter rest for 10β15 minutes.
Step 2: Cook the Crepes
- Heat a non-stick pan over medium heat.
- Pour a thin layer of batter and swirl to spread evenly.
- Cook for about 1β2 minutes per side until lightly golden.
- Stack crepes and let cool slightly.
Step 3: Add the Filling
- Spread a generous layer of chocolate spread over each crepe.
- Sprinkle crushed Maltesers and chocolate chips on top.
Step 4: Roll and Slice
- Roll each crepe tightly like a log.
- Slice into bite-sized rolls.
Step 5: Decorate
- Drizzle melted chocolate over the rolls.
- Top with whole Maltesers and crushed biscuits for crunch.
β¨ Pro Tips
- Use low heat for crepes β keeps them soft and flexible.
- Donβt overfill β easier to roll neatly.
- Chill rolls 10 minutes before cutting β cleaner slices.
